Northeast is ’Dawgs’ first state opponent
- Thu, Mar, 19, 2009
Seeking the program’s first-ever basketball state championship, Bearden takes a 35-2 record and No. 1 state ranking into the Boys Class AAA State Tournament in Murphy Center, Middle Tennessee State University, Murfreesboro, beginning today, Thursday, March 19.
Clarksville-based Northeast (26-6) is the Bulldogs’ quarterfinal round opponent beginning at 6 p.m. (5 p.m. CDT) Thursday, March 19.
A BHS win sends Bearden into semifinal action versus the Memphis White Station (28-7)-Chattanooga Red Bank (20-14) winner, with opening tip-off set for 7:45 p.m. (6:45 CDT), Friday, March 20.
Title game begins at 7 p.m. (6 p.m. CDT), Saturday, March 21, pitting the Bulldogs’ side of the bracket against one of these four: Walker Valley of Cleveland (33-1), Johnson City Science Hill (31-4), Memphis Raleigh Egypt (33-2) or Henderson-ville Beech (29-4).
